Output dd5a7bdbd5c8d8e743fe930ed2fce994579c8257e27e6532ea6f77544faf61bd:1

value
37370654
script pubkey
OP_0 OP_PUSHBYTES_20 6a60b9a3109168c6083f6fb083a7acc21b7fc1aa
address
bc1qdfstngcsj95vvzpld7cg8favcgdhlsd26g3gch
transaction
dd5a7bdbd5c8d8e743fe930ed2fce994579c8257e27e6532ea6f77544faf61bd
confirmations
282385
spent
true